Are you referring to the Trace "PC-250", the one built by Pulse Energy (or 
Ananda...or Connect...or whatever they were called at the time)? It's the one 
with a charge controller board built-in, and knockouts for small breakers on 
the front hinged door.

The "DC-250" is still made by Xantrex, but only contains a main breaker, and no 
boards, and has small-breaker knockouts on the sides. The door is not hinged
